How To Use Google’s Circle to Search

The concept is simple. Just press and hold the home button on the screen to enable Circle to Search, and then do just that. It’s a visual look-up tool that allows you to quickly get more information about a pair of boots you see on Instagram or an unknown landmark in a YouTube video.
